SRX5600E-BASE-AC Overview
SRX5600 base model includes chassis, midplane, SRX5K-RE-1800X4, SRX5K-SCBE, 2xAC HC PEM, HC fan tray, Supported by Junos 12.1X47-D15 onwards SRX5600E-BASE-AC

What core components are included in the SRX5600E-BASE-AC configuration? +
The SRX5600E-BASE-AC serves as a foundational platform, shipping with a high-capacity chassis and midplane, one SRX5K-RE-1800X4 routing engine, and a single SRX5K-SCBE switch control board. Additionally, the unit is equipped with two high-capacity AC power entry modules (PEMs) and a high-capacity fan tray, providing the essential thermal and electrical infrastructure required for reliable enterprise-grade gateway operations.
What is the minimum software version requirement for the SRX5600E-BASE-AC? +
This specific gateway model requires Junos OS release 12.1X47-D15 or any subsequent version for proper operation. What is the primary function of the SRX5K-SCBE included in this kit? +
The SRX5K-SCBE, or Switch Control Board, acts as the fabric interface for the gateway. It facilitates high-speed data plane switching between the routing engine and the various line cards installed in the chassis. This component is critical for maintaining internal backplane communication, ensuring that packets are correctly routed through the system with minimal latency and high efficiency.
